Nestled amidst breath-taking scenery, Elstree View is enveloped by expansive greenery, creating a picturesque setting for resident enjoyment. Renowned for its exceptional assisted living services, the Elstree care home extends comprehensive care, encompassing dementia care, respite care, nursing care and palliative care.

Funding & Fees

Weekly Charges per Person

Type of carePermanentRespite
Residential CareFrom £1,550From £1,650
Residential Dementia CareFrom £1,600From £1,700

Choosing a home for an elderly parent is daunting. Signature at Elstree has proven to be the best possible choice for my mother. The residents are treated with dignity, are all well-presented, and the home is immaculate. Staff members are approachable and friendly. The menu choices are well-planned - my mother has gained weight since she arrived, which was very necessary! The home provides entertainment and a varied programme of activities. The activities coordinators also offer outings for those wishing to venture out. Hairdressing, manicure and chiropody are all available on-site. The home is well-managed.
